Displaying 19 - 24 of 44
Chipping Campden Lab
Friday 14 March 2025
-
Gloucester Lab
Wednesday 19 March 2025
-
Chipping Campden Lab
Friday 21 March 2025
-
Gloucester Lab
Wednesday 26 March 2025
-
Chipping Campden Lab
Friday 28 March 2025
-
Chipping Campden Lab
Saturday 29 March 2025
-